Truly amazing record run of renewable energy carrying 100% of California’s grid for portions of the day:

43 straight days — and 67 out of 73 days — where clean energy exceeded 100% of demand.

5th largest economy on the world, 39 million people and over a million EVs on the road here.

Right now renewables are producing 103% of demand and it’s 3:30pm here. It’s just amazing and should bring immense hope around the world!

" accounted for more than 30% of the world’s electricity for the first time last year following a rapid rise in wind and solar power, according to new figures.

The surge in clean electricity is expected to power a 2% decrease in global fossil fuel generation in the year ahead, according to Ember."

"The US gets just 23 percent of its electricity from #RenewableEnergy.

The [Biden] administration’s ability to mandate a transition to cleaner energy is limited after SCOTUS decided in 2022 that the EPA shouldn’t be allowed to determine how the US generates its electricity. Since then, the #EPA’s long-awaited rules for greenhouse gas emissions from power plants have leaned on getting energy companies to capture carbon dioxide emissions from burning fossil fuels."

" are meeting 95% of ’s electricity needs.

Fossil gas met just 9 per cent of demand in the first four months of 2024, with gas consumption in the power sector halving compared to the same period in 2023."

"...solar roof tiles are solar panels that look like roof tiles.... Much like solar panels, they comprise semi-conducting materials that generate an electric charge and send it to an inverter and eventually a home and/or solar battery.

Unlike bolted-on roof panels, they take the place of the tiling on the roof and become part of the structure of the home."

Seven countries, two in Europe, are now powered 100% by renewable energy!

  • Albania,
  • Bhutan,
  • Ethiopia,
  • Iceland,
  • Nepal,
  • Paraguay, and
  • The Democratic Republic of Congo

Norway was close at over 98%.

Renewables growth still lags climate targets, think tank says

"The world added less than half of the new capacity needed to meet its climate goals last year, with rising energy demand and weak infrastructure slowing the shift from fossil fuels.

"The reality is that energy demand has increased at the same time, especially in China, India and other developing economies," said Rana Adib, REN21's Executive Secretary."

But the trend is UP, and steeply:

"Global renewable capacity additions increased by 36% last year to reach around 473 gigawatts (GW), breaking the record for the 22nd consecutive year."

In 2020:
"Globally, 260 gigawatts (GW) of renewable energy capacity were added.
More than 80% of all new electricity capacity added [that] year was renewable."

The EU installed a record 16.2 GW of wind power capacity last year, and WindEurope expects this to grow to an average of 29 GW/year in the period up to 2030.
Permitting is speeding up, grids seen as the main bottleneck now.
